PM reaches Varanasi to thank his voters

Varanasi, :  Prime Minister-designate Narendra Modi arrived in the temple city of Varanasi on Monday morning by a special aircraft.
At the airport Mr Modi was welcomed by UP governor Ram Naik, BJP president Amit Shah and UP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ath. From airport Modi left for Kashi Vishwanath temple where he will offer special prayers. BJP president Amit Shah, UP governor and CM would also accompany him to Kashi Vishwanath temple.
Mr Modi’s arrival in Varanasi is being considered as a thanksgiving visit before taking oath of the PM for the second term on May 30. The security has been spruced up at Kashi Vishwanath temple and at Hastkala Shakul at Bara Lalpur, where the PM would be visiting.
At Hastkala Shakul at Bara Lalpur, the Varanasi MP would be addressing the party workers before leaving for New Delhi.
Mr Modi won the Varanasi parliamentary seat by a huge margin of 4,79,505 votes, defeating his nearest rival Shalini Yadav of the Samajwadi Party.
BJP’s Kashi region spokesperson Navratan Rathi said that party workers have done adequate arrangements to give a grand welcome to their leader by showering petals on his way to the Kashi Vishwanath temple and other places.
